What is Mini Miracles Learning Center?
Mini Miracles Learning Center operates as a premier provider of preschool and comprehensive childcare services, distinguished by its military-family-owned heritage. The company distinguishes itself through the implementation of the STREAMin3 curriculum, which integrates science, technology, reading, engineering, arts, and mathematics into foundational learning for children aged 6 weeks to 12 years. By maintaining low teacher-to-child ratios and prioritizing rigorous security protocols, the center addresses the critical demand for reliable, high-standard educational environments. Its market position is further solidified by a focus on operational convenience, including integrated meal services and real-time parental communication via proprietary digital platforms, catering to the needs of modern, busy families.
